Yarralumla Play Station at Weston Park is the old Weston Park Railway

They are one and the same, but new owners have revamped and restored Yarralumla Play Station with a whole bunch of new activities and fun.

Plus they’ve restored three historic NSW train carriages circa 1910 for functions and events on site.

yarralumla play station bluebell train sign pic

Yarralumla Train Rides

At Yarralumla Play Station, kids and families can take a 9-minute train ride loop on the Western Park railway around the figure-eight track, riding the sweet “Bluebell” train.

Bluebell was specially commissioned and built by the Bermagui Foundary for Yarralumla Play Station.

Bluebell chuggs her way past old relic full-size train carriages from 1910, past a giant anti-submarine gun from theDestroyer HMAS Vampire.

Weston Park Train Ride – Need to Know

The train at Weston Park has new canopies to shade the kids from the sun and light rain.

Keep an eye out for the new accessible carriage which will be able to take wheelchairs and prams too.

Wave at the mini-golfers as they saunter their way around the course.

Close your eyes when you go through the tunnel, and open them when you pop out the other side, you’ll be in the magical Pine Forest.

Home to a Farm Yard full of friendly farm animals.

Do stop off for a pat and a cuddle at the mini farm full of our favourite fuzzy farm animals.

MORE THINGS TO DO AT YARRALUMLA PLAY STATION

No.1: Yarralumla Canberra Mini Golf

Weston Park Mini Golf is one of the largest ‘putt putt’ golf courses in Australia,  and you can play a round or two of ‘mini’ golf  on one of the two specially designed courses with iconic Canberra sights including Lake Burley Griffin.

Yarralumla mini golf provides everything you need:

  • colour coded balls
  • putters
  • scorecards, and
  • pencils.

It’s all included in the price.

No.3 Swimming at Yarralumla Park

There’s a swimming enclosure close by, on the lake.

It’s a top spot to cool off on a blisteringly hot Canberra day.

Opening Hours at Yarralumla Play Station

  • Monday to Friday – 8:30am to 4:30pm
  • Saturday and Sunday – 8:00am to 5:30pm

Closed Christmas Day and Boxing Day

yarralumla play station weston park train ticket prices sign pic

Yarralumla Play Station Entry Fees

Weston Park Railway Ticket Pricing & Farm Friends

  • Single passenger tickets – all ages  $5 each
  • Ten or more tickets purchased by the same person – $4 each
  • Adult train ride with Farm stop – $15 each
  • Child train ride with Farm stop – $12 each
  • Family train ride with Farm stop (2 A & 2 C, or 1 A & 3 C) – $50
  • Extra child in same family $10

Children under 5 must have an accompanying adult to travel.

All babies 12 months or under ride for free.

During open hours, Bluebell tours depart every 30 minutes dependant on demand and weather conditions. Train requires a minimum of two passengers to depart.

No food or drink allowed on train.

Please keep all body parts inside the carriage at all times.

yarralumla play station tickets sign pic

Yarralumla Play Station Prices for Mini Golf Putt Putt 

  • Children (under 15 years) –  $10 (18 holes) or $15 (36 holes)
  • Adults –  $14 (18 holes) or $20 (36 holes)
  • Family Pass ( 1 A & 3 C, or 2 A & 2 C) –  $40 (18 holes) or $60 (36 holes)
  • Extra child on Family Pass –  $5 (18 holes) or $8 (36 holes)
